Concrete or Bricks/Tile – Seperated

These loads consist of separated concrete & concrete products such as roof tiles & concrete bricks/pavers OR clay products, such as bricks/pavers.

STRICTLY – 100% Clean and separated materials suitable for recycling without sorting.

Loads Can Be

  • 100% clean materials
  • Up to 1.4 tonnes per cubic metre
  • Concrete and reinforcing steel with only incidental dirt
  • Concrete & Concrete Products, i.e. bricks, roof tiles, concrete pavers (can be mixed)
  • ORClay Bricks, Clay Pavers & Clay Products, i.e. Terracotta Roof Tiles (can be mixed)

What you CANNOT put in the Bin

  • Prohibited Waste Types
  • Concrete Dust from Grinding
  • Unsuitable materials include asphalt, dirt, gravel, plastic, grass, green waste, wood, glass and any other form of contaminates
  • Ceramic Tiles
  • Any other rubbish
